Output 177f223cd4c4b4540b8cc6648b5c8e6832ae6f3395a7f630d5d1af36d2079879:33

value
2137149
script pubkey
OP_0 OP_PUSHBYTES_20 1f0f34661aaf5627699363bd731e756b73446cc6
address
bc1qru8nges64atzw6vnvw7hx8n4dde5gmxx84m5sf
transaction
177f223cd4c4b4540b8cc6648b5c8e6832ae6f3395a7f630d5d1af36d2079879
confirmations
189666
spent
true